Our Puny Human Brains Are Terrible at Thinking About the Future
Our current political climate in the United States reflects this same cognitive bias against the future. Recently, President Trump signed a sweeping executive order undoing a vast array of regulations designed to mitigate long-term climate change in favor of policies that provide much shorter-term economic benefits. And Treasury Secretary Steven Mnuchin recently made headlines when he said publicly that he is "not worried at all" about the possibility automation could eliminate millions or even tens of millions of American jobs in the future. "It's not even on our radar screen," he said, adding that it won't happen for "50 to 100 years or more." But, as Daniel Gross wrote in Slate, he's wrong.
